Allayer Announces First Fast Ethernet Twisted-pair to Fiber Converter IC.


SAN JOSE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--June 7, 1999--

Allayer Technologies Corp. announces a single-chip transceiver that converts twisted-pair Fast Ethernet See 100BaseT. (100Base-TX) signals into fiber-optic Fast Ethernet (100Base-FX). The AL210 supports redundant fiber links for fault-tolerant connections and conforms to the IEEE802.3 Ethernet standard.

It replaces five chips and enables the design of low-cost converter modules that economically connect PCs and workstations to fiber optic networks. Key elements include a channel that receives twisted pair Fast Ethernet signals and performs clock recovery, a descrambler that forwards data to the LED driver, a quantizer that decodes fiber waveforms, a clock recovery circuit, and an elastic store that formats data for transmission over the Fast Ethernet transmitter. The AL210 provides fault tolerant features that improve network reliability and supports both 850 nm and 1300 nm fiber modules.

The AL210 is in production and is priced at $11.50 in a 48-pin PQFP PQFP - Plastic Quad Flat Package (Plastic Quad Flat Pak) in quantities of 1,000.
